My homeowner's insurance premium increased 18% this year. Can roof upgrades help reduce costs?

Yes, Virginia insurers now offer significant premium reductions for roofs meeting IBHS FORTIFIED Home standards. These voluntary upgrades include enhanced roof deck attachment, sealed roof deck seams, and impact-resistant shingles. The certification demonstrates reduced storm damage risk, translating to lower claims exposure for insurers. Many Dunn Loring homeowners see premium savings that offset upgrade costs within 5-7 years, while also improving home resilience against our severe thunderstorm season.

Should I consider solar shingles instead of traditional asphalt when replacing my roof?

The decision balances upfront cost against long-term energy savings. Traditional architectural asphalt shingles cost less initially and work with standard rack-mounted solar panels. Solar shingles integrate photovoltaic cells directly into the roofing material but carry higher installation costs. With Virginia's 1:1 net metering and the 30% federal investment tax credit available in 2026, both approaches offer financial benefits. For Dunn Loring homes with good southern exposure, solar-ready roofs with traditional shingles often provide the best balance of storm resilience and energy production.

What roof features matter most for Dunn Loring's wind and hail risks?

Dunn Loring's 115 mph wind zone (ASCE 7-22) requires proper shingle installation with six nails per shingle and sealed roof deck edges. Class 4 impact-resistant shingles are financially necessary given our moderate hail risk of 1.0-1.5 inch stones during May-August thunderstorms. These shingles withstand hail impacts that would damage standard products, reducing insurance claims and preventing water intrusion. Combined with FORTIFIED standards, they create a system that performs during peak storm seasons including tropical systems in September.

What are the current code requirements for roof replacements in Fairfax County?

Fairfax County Land Development Services requires permits for all roof replacements, following the 2021 IRC with 2024 Virginia amendments. Virginia DPOR licenses all roofing contractors. Current code mandates ice and water shield installation along eaves and valleys in Dunn Loring, extending up the roof slope specific distances based on pitch. Flashing details around chimneys, vents, and walls must create continuous water barriers. These requirements address common failure points in our climate and ensure installations withstand the documented wind and precipitation loads.

Can poor roof ventilation really cause attic mold problems?

Improper ventilation on 4/12 pitch roofs creates ideal conditions for attic mold growth. The 2021 IRC with Virginia amendments requires specific intake and exhaust ratios to maintain proper airflow. Without adequate ventilation, summer heat builds up in attics, superheating shingles and reducing their lifespan. Winter moisture from household activities condenses on cold surfaces, promoting mold growth on roof decking. Properly balanced systems use soffit vents for intake and ridge vents for exhaust to maintain consistent temperatures year-round.
